Biography
Born in Buenos Aires, he settled in Spain with his family at a young age. He studied Dramatic Arts with Cristina Rota and Daniel Sánchez. To complete his studies, he took dance classes with Agustín Belusci. His first main role was given to him by Fernando Colomo in 1998, as the main character in the film Los años bárbaros, for which he was nominated for the Goya Award as Best New Actor. Colomo relied on him again for the film Cuarteto de La Habana. Later, he worked on films such as Los lobos de Washington, by Mariano Barroso (for which he won the Best Actor Award at the Toulouse Film Festival) or Yoyes, by Elena Taberna (for which he was again awarded as Best Actor at the Toulouse Film Festival). From that moment on Ernesto’s career developed solidly and he worked with some of the best directors in Spanish cinema, in films such as David Serrano’s Football Days (2003), for which he was nominated for the Goya Award for Best Leading Actor or Marcelo Piñeiro’s The Method (2005), for which he was nominated for the Silver Condor Award in Argentina. His filmography includes The Widows of Thursdays (2009), by Marcelo Piñeiro, Clandestine Childhood (2011), directed by Benjamín Ávila, Who Killed Bambi? (2013), directed by Santi Amodeo, Easy Sex, Sad Movies (2014), directed by Alejo Flah, Perfectos desconocidos (2017) by Álex de la Iglesia, La Sombra de la Ley (2018) directed by Dani de la Torre and Lo dejo cuando quiera (2019) by Carlos Therón. Ernesto has always combined his work in film with theatre and television. Highlights of his theatre career are plays like Oedipus Rex, directed by Jorge Lavelli, and Yo, el heredero, directed by Francesco Saporano. On television, he has starred in highly successful series such as Juan José Campanella’s Vientos de Agua, Ignacio Mercero’s La chica de ayer and Félix Viscarret’s Marco. He also participated on Netflix’s Las Chicas del Cable and Narcos and David Galán’s Orígenes Secretos.
